A Book Behind Bars: The Robben Island Shakespeare

An excellent resource in researching the Robben Island Bible:


A Book Behind Bars: The Robben Island Shakespeare, one of the Exhibitions at the Folger, opened on May 25, 2013 and closed on October 2, 2013. The exhibition highlights a 1970 edition of The Alexander Text of the Complete Works of Shakespeare that circulated throughout the Robben Island prison in South Africa from 1975 to 1978.

Matthew Hahn
Matthew Hahn is an independent creative producer, playwright, theatre director & theatre for development facilitator specialising in creating theatre for social change, for examining behaviour and for improving communication skills.He works both nationally and internationally.As a theatre for development practitioner, he facilitates interactive and participatory theatre projects focusing on social cohesion, peace-making and conflict resolution.His play,The Robben Island Shakespeare, has been performed in the United Kingdom, United States and South Africa;he regularly facilitates Ethical Leadership Workshops based on his interviews with former South African political prisoners and selections from The Complete Works of William Shakespeare.Matthew has degrees in Political Science & Journalism from Indiana University,United States & is a graduate of the Goldsmiths College Masters in Theatre Directing programme, UK.He trained with the SITI Company in New York & with Anne Bogart in Dublin, Ireland.He has also trained with the Cardboard Citizens Theatre Company in London in their Forum Theatre / Joker Training Programme.
